Mojiworks is a leader in games for Discord, a pioneer of next generation social games with 140M players and counting, and a 7x winner of GamesIndustry.biz’s Best Places To Work awards.

Since 2016 we’ve led the way in using modern social apps as places for a new type of game. Played in the online places where friends already hang out, our games are designed to strengthen friendships and start new ones through the joy of playing together.

Mojiworks is an online & remote company, with an administrative HQ in Guildford, UK - a renowned game industry hub. We’re distributed across locations, and highly collaborative using Slack text & video. We pride ourselves on our strong personal connections & community (which we put a lot of effort in to).

We believe that being online, rather than physically centralised, makes us the best team: we can have diverse talent from all over the world; better support individual working needs; and lift everyone up to have the same opportunity for impact & collaboration.

We work flexibly, but coordinate around Europe/Middle-East/Africa timezones.
